torsdag den 18. oktober 2018

Postgresql index for integer

Postgresql index for integer

Simply put, an index is a pointer to data in a table. An index in a database is very similar to an index in the back of a book. Short answer: integer is faster than varchar or text in every aspect.


How to create an index on an integer json property in. Best index for column where values are mostly the. You can also create a UNIQUE index on a column. Below is a simplified example of the index on one field with integer keys.


Provide an integer value from to 1to the fillfactor parameter to tune how packed the . So if I take a totally random . Indexes : series_pkey PRIMARY . This enables very fast reads from that subset with almost no index. Each of these indexes is useful, but which to use depends on the data type, underlying data, and types . This is the index type which makes all JSONB set operations fast. Postgres has a number of index types. For example, Datatypes like integers – dates where sort order is . It would have integers values and they would be unique as well. B-tree, Hash, GiST, SP- GiST and GIN.


Postgresql index for integer

The student scores is an array of integers , but since we will insert four. It definitely looks like it should be slower – after all – integer takes bytes. NOT NULL, city character varying(40) NOT.


We were using 8-byte bigint types for small integer keys, and 8-byte. Suppose you want to index million integer values. We have all heard about indexes. I did not design this table but the customer is fixing it (adding proper primary key, changing to boolean and integer where appropriate etc). Getting the index column order right will vastly improve performance.


But what are all these index. The purpose of an index only scan is to fetch . A common heuristic for indexing database tables is to index the columns you use for sorting, filtering, joining, or grouping. CREATE TABLE test_schema. There are a fair number of options however to be . They are intended to improve. With Netezza Always Use Integer Join Keys For Good Compression, Zone Maps, And Joins.


The following example PostGreSQL commands will create a new indexed column:. Both “key” columns are primary keys with proper indexing. One of ( postgresql ,sql, postgres ,pgsql,psql) space One of (do,is,use,make). Hi All, I have a requirement to port a table from MySQL database server to postgreSQL Database server.


The main difference between a UUID and an Integer as a primary key, is if. LINE 3: invoiceid integer REFERENCES. Do we understand where our indexes are working for us an more.

Ingen kommentarer:

Send en kommentar

Bemærk! Kun medlemmer af denne blog kan sende kommentarer.

Populære indlæg